The first $1 bill featured Salmon P. Chase, former Treasury Secretary and Chief Justice of the Supreme Court. ... The Treasury Department, in recognition of his role in the creation of the greenback, used Chase's portrait on the $10,000 bill, which was in circulation until 1945. Being on the $10,000 is a step up from the $1.

Once upon a …The History of the $1,000 Dollar Bill A rare find today, $1,000 dollar bills are genuine U.S. legal tender. Last printed in 1945, the government stopped the distribution of this denomination by 1969. These large bills were used for inter-bank and large private transactions, such as making a down payment on a house, and were seldom seen in ...

... $10,000 to the spouse, any child, the father or mother, or any sister or ... bill or an affidavit, executed by a licensed funeral director which sets forth ...The largest hoard of $10,000 bills was the Binion Hoard of 100 $10,000 bills that was on display at the Binion Horseshoe and Casino in Las Vegas from 1954 to 1999. The Inverted Horseshoe which housed the 100 bills was disassembled in December of 1999 and the 100 $10K NY notes were sold off in 2000.1878 $10,000 bill obverse; 1878 $10,000 bill reverse; Andrew Jackson is portrayed on the obverse (face side) of the 1878 $10,000 bill with an eagle holding arrows and a sword atop an American flag and shield. Dapatkan nilai tukar langsung, nilai tukar historis dan data stat & grafik mata uang.Feb 4, 2021 · The faces on larger denominations that are out of circulation—the $500, $1,000, $5,000, $10,000, and $100,000 bills—are also those of men who served as president and Treasury secretary. The Treasury stopped printing the larger notes in 1945, but most continued to circulate until 1969 when the Federal Reserve began destroying those that were ... The Treasury announced on July 14, 1969, that it would quit issuing the $500, $1,000, $5,000, and $10,000 notes immediately, since the bills were so sparsely circulated.For example, $10,000 bill that is kept in pristine condition could be worth as much as $140,000. Pass entries in the books ...The 10,000 dollar bill was the largest sized bill ever issued to the American public. It's a real bill but the public rarely ever saw one because they were used exclusively for bank transfers and other large transactions.
